Who We Are:
  • Coca-Cola Beverages Florida, LLC (Coke Florida) is a family-owned independent Coca-Cola bottler that is the third largestprivately-heldand the sixth largest independent Coca-Cola bottler in the United States.
  • Coke Florida sells, markets, manufactures and distributes over 600 products of The Coca-Cola Company and other partner companies including Monster Beverage Corporation and BODYARMOR.
  • In 2026, for the 5th year in a row, Coke Florida was named as a US Best Managed Company by Deloitte Private and The Wall Street Journal. This program recognizes outstanding U.S. private companies and the achievements of their management teams in four key areas: strategy, ability to execute, corporate culture, and governance/financial performance.

Coke Florida is looking for a Principal Enterprise Architect based out of our Tampa HQ location.

The Principal Enterprise Architect is responsible for enabling the technology vision, define architectural standards, and drive digital transformation by ensuring systems and technology decisions drive secure business value, scalability, resiliency, and future-proof supporting and leading the design, alignment, and governance of enterprise architecture strategy acrossour business units and affiliates (which encompasses a multi-company/division organization for a variety of businesses and business models). This role is accountable for shaping the long-term architecture vision forapplications, enterprise platforms, services, and associated IT infrastructure. The role requires someone who can analyze trends, signals and disruptors in technology to improve the enterprise architecture to take advantage of them to meet ever evolving business needs. The Principal Enterprise Architect will serve as a trusted advisor to executives and IT leadership, bridging strategy and execution while leading cross-functional architecture efforts that unify business needs with technical capabilities. This role involves overseeing the architecture for enterprise-level systems.
